#4 The continuation of the Hangman Page and The Elite storyline at AEW All Out

The most compelling storyline in wrestling has to be the ongoing saga within The Elite. Heading into AEW All Out, the buildup to the AEW World Tag Team Championship match made it the most anticipated encounter of the night. Although the crowd was not quite lively and the match felt too long, the tag team title contest was well worked and told an effective story. The post-match was where the storyline beforehand was further developed at AEW All Out.

After their loss of the titles at AEW All Out, Kenny Omega looked frustrated and angry. The Best Bout Machine had the timekeeper's table in hand and looked like he would turn on Hangman Page, but he did not. However when a beaten-down Page went to embrace his partner, Omega let him fall straight on his face then kicked his beer out of the ring onto a ringside camera in a stellar visual.

Kenny Omega would then walk to the back where he was met by The Young Bucks. Omega told Matt and Nick that he wanted a "clean start" after AEW All Out. With their loss and Page being ousted from The Elite, Kenny gave the Bucks an ultimatum of sorts asking them to get in the car if they are with him, which the Jacksons did not. With the earlier aggressiveness in their encounter with Jurassic Express earlier on AEW All Out, their decision added another layer to this captivating story in AEW.
